Microsoft 365 app 2302 update: resolving issues in Access, Outlook, Project and Word

Microsoft has released update 2302 for the current channel of Microsoft 365 Enterprise, Microsoft 365 Business, and the subscription versions of Project and Visio desktop applications. The major version number is 2302 and the internal version number is 16130.20306.

The full release notes for this update:

Resolved issues

Access

  • Resolves an error: 3155, ODBC – Insert message on linked table [table name] that users receive when inserting a new row into a linked SQL Server table with an INSERT trigger.

Outlook

  • Fixed an issue that caused users in Government Cloud Tenant to be unable to launch To-Do items in Outlook.
  • Fixes an issue that caused users to see an inaccurate count of the number of new notifications when opening the Notifications pane.

Project

  • Fixed an issue that caused the start date of a manually scheduled task to be later than its completion date when opening an XML file in Project.

Word

  • Fixed the error message “The last time I opened a file name it caused a serious error. Do you still want to open it?” in Word. This could occur when using templates to create Word documents through automation.

In addition, Microsoft has released the following security updates for Excel and Outlook.

Excel

  • CVE-2023-23399
  • CVE-2023-23398

Outlook

  • CVE-2023-23397

Microsoft cautions that features (and sometimes fixes) are sent to the current channel over a period of time, so if users are still experiencing any issues that have apparently been fixed, please also be patient and wait for the update to be pushed.
